WebMar 8, 2024 · 1. Always wear protective gloves when applying baking soda and vinegar to clean black sludge. The acidity in vinegar can irritate the skin, while baking soda can cause skin dryness and irritation if given in contact with the skin for too long. 2. When cleaning with vinegar and baking soda, ensure that the area is well-ventilated. WebJun 10, 2024 · Add 1/2 cup of vinegar. Let the mixture sit for 30 minutes. Flush with hot water. The baking soda and vinegar will react and create a fizzy mixture that will help break down the gunk and bacteria in your drains. The last process is to rinse with cold water to remove any leftover residue.

Noticing black slime creeping up from your drain or building up … WebMar 28, 2024 · Step 1: Remove the Clean-Out Plug. Find a clean-out plug located on a large drainpipe in areas such as your basement, crawlspace, garage or near the foundation of your house. Remove the plug with an adjustable wrench. Wastewater may drain out when you open the clean-out and when you break the clog. Stand clear as you remove the …

WebJan 5, 2024 · It’s often found in lakes, rivers and underground water supplies. The black slime that accumulates on spouts is bacteria that feed on oxidized iron and manganese in the water. Manganese, as shown above, is a naturally occurring mineral. Pro tip: The best way to clean the black gunk off your faucets and fixtures is by using a non-toxic cleaner.
